After the high school entrance examination, the choice of general high school and vocational high school is determined by cultural points. What is the difference between the two?

thumbnail

First, let’s talk about the difference between vocational high school and general high school:

  1. General high school (general high school), generally you can take the college entrance examination after graduation. Vocational high school (vocational high school) and general high school (general high school) are not much different from the examination, but the technical and professional requirements of vocational high school are more focused. more, while Pagoda is more culturally demanding.

  2. In terms of teaching quality, the teaching team of vocational high school emphasizes operational theory and technical theory, and the overall quality is weaker than that of general high school, and the teaching theory is also different from general high school.

  3. Ordinary high schools are not divided into majors, but vocational high schools have to classify different majors from the beginning of high school.

  4. Vocational high schools mainly learn vocational skills through several years, and graduates can get the corresponding vocational certificates for employment, while ordinary high schools study high school textbooks within a few years, and get high school diplomas after graduation.

  5. Vocational high schools and general high schools have different key training objects. Vocational high schools cultivate talents with professional skills, while ordinary high schools will have many employment directions to continue their studies when they take the college entrance examination.
